Audit tasks
The National Audit Office conducts annual audits of all accounting agencies. These totalled 115 at the beginning of 2004. Audits cover state budget funds, operational financing and funds that are received from outside sources such as the European Union or transferred to them.
Financial audits focus on compliance with the state budget and regulations concerning its application, the provision of correct and adequate information in financial statements and the proper arranging of internal control.
Financial audits also ensure the correctness of the state's central bookkeeping and the reliability of the state's financial statements.
Financial audits take into consideration the National Audit Office's task, available resources and the implementation of principles, approaches and standards regarding audits of the state economy. The Office has prepared a manual that sets out its concept of good auditing practice in state administration.
